The Tampa Bay Rays on Friday announced that stars Manny Ramirez and Johnny Damon will be joining the team, thus helping to improve the Rays odds of winning a 2011 World Series.
Currently, those odds were at 30/1 at BetED.com.
Other clubs were widely pursuing the two players prior to Friday’s announcement. Damon agreed to a one-year deal that would pay out $5.25 million plus incentives while Ramirez agreed to a one year contract for $2 million.
Damon, 37, hit .271 laast season with a .756 OPS in 549 at-bats for the Detroit Tigers. Ramirez, 38, hit nine home runs with a .298 average and .870 OPS in 265 at-bats for the Los Angeles Dodgers and Chicago White Sox.
